Tafelmusik Baroque Summer Institute
Hello!
I've been in Toronto for the past five days attending a two-week program with Tafelmusik, learning all about Baroque music. It's a lot to take in but I'm having a blast and learning a lot! With about 100 participants from all over the world, everyone gets to participate in masterclasses, have lessons, play in orchestras and chamber ensembles, and attend lectures and workshops. It feels as if I've been here for a year already but it's only day 4! The people are great and there's always something exciting to do. Hopefully it stops raining soon!
